Texas passed legislation allowing drivers to show proof of liability insurance on their cell phone. A bill introduced by Sen. Glenn Hegar, R-Katy has passed now allowing Texans to show proof of Auto Liability insurance on their cell phone or wireless device.

Does Texas allow electronic proof of insurance?

States with Legislation Permitting Electronic Copies of Car Insurance. Texas joins a group of 27 other states allowing the use of electronic devices to show proof of insurance.

Do you have to carry proof of insurance in Texas?

Is auto insurance required? Texas law requires drivers to show proof they can pay for the accidents they cause. Most drivers do this by buying auto liability insurance.

How can I get out of a no proof of insurance ticket in Texas?

However, if you do have insurance, but were unable to prove it at the time, you can appeal your ticket in court. You will need to provide proof that you were insured at the time you received your ticket, and the court will dismiss the fine. You will still be on the hook for the administrative fee.

What is considered proof of insurance?

Proof of insurance can be in the form of an insurance ID card or other document from your insurance company. To meet the proof of insurance requirements, your ID card or form must show the policy number, policy effective dates, covered vehicle, and policyholder name.

How much is a no proof of insurance ticket in Georgia?

When a person has insurance but does not provide proof to a police officer, they will be charged with No Proof of Insurance. The maximum fine, in this situation, cannot exceed $25. When a person attends court, the prosecutor (solicitor) will ask the accused if they had valid insurance when they were ticketed.
